Heated steering wheel module location

I have a 2017 Lariat with heated and adaptive steering. The heated steering is not working this fall and am leading to believe the module is bad. I cannot seem to find any information as to where it is located. Anyone have any ideas?

The module is located behind the the knee pannel on the driver side behind the metal plate.


The hswm is located in the area with the red circle is. The module in the picture is the spotlight modle but the heated steering wheel module is located right next to it.

Are you sure it’s not the element in the steering wheel? I have adaptive steering too. Just went through this and they replaced the wheel, on my extended warranty. Ohm out the element to ensure it’s not broken. If you have a dealer or extended warranty you can trust, probably best to start there. Just cause the safety issues with airbags and clock springs, very specific safety procedures.
